MūL Technologies produces MARC autonomous mobile robotic carts. These robots handle material transport in warehouses, manufacturing plants, and logistics operations. The design relies on standard commercial parts with added smarts for movement, keeping costs low and setup under 10 minutes. Companies gain automation benefits without high prices or complexity. ROI comes in weeks through transparent online pricing.

Autonomous Mobile Robots (AMRs) are intelligent robotic vehicles equipped with advanced sensors, artificial intelligence, and navigation software that enable them to move and operate independently within dynamic environments, such as warehouses, manufacturing plants, and logistics hubs.

NODE Robotics develops advanced software solutions for mobile robots, specializing in autonomous intralogistics. Their platform, NODE.OS, offers plug-and-play capabilities that facilitate seamless integration with various robotic systems, enhancing operational efficiency. The software supports a wide range of functionalities, including localization, navigation, and fleet management, enabling diverse applications in demanding environments. With a focus on modular design, NODE Robotics provides flexible solutions tailored to the specific needs of original equipment manufacturers (OEMs).

Robust.AI develops collaborative autonomous mobile robots (AMRs) for warehouse logistics, using AI-powered software called Grace to manage robot fleets. Their flagship product Carter™ Pro is a mobile robot designed to enhance material handling, optimize workflows, and improve warehouse productivity by seamlessly working alongside human workers.
